The Signs A Pipe May Need Relining

If you’re unsure whether or not your pipes require relining, here are some indicators to look for:

  • Water leakage
  • Odors coming from your drains
  • There are gurgling sounds coming from your drains
  • Slow drainage or clogs

Should I Have My Pipe Replaced or Relined?

That is a question that homeowners from all walks of life will have to ask at time. Both options are a choice with pros and cons and it can be difficult to determine what is best for you. Here are some things to consider:

Relining

  • Relining is less expensive than replacing.
  • You can do it without tearing out your walls or floor.
  • It is feasible to do it fast, usually in a day or two.
  • There is less of a mess to make after the project is done.
  • The new liner will last for many years.

Replacement

  • Replacement is more expensive than the process of relining.
  • It’s a messy job and you might require to leave the house for a few days as it is being done.
  • The new pipe should last for many years.

Approximately, How Long Will Pipe Relining Last?

One of the major advantages of sliplining is that it is able to last for a long time. In actual fact, it is not uncommon for pipe relining to last for as long as 50 years. This is a major improvement over conventional methods such as excavation, which typically last between 10 and 15 years.

Can You Reline Pipes That Have Bends In Them?

Trenchless pipe relining is a wonderful, non-dig solution to repair damaged pipes with bends in their pipe. The pipe relining process creates an entirely new pipe inside the pipe that is already in place. This means you don’t have to remove the old pipe and can fix it without having to dig the driveway or your yard.

The difficulties of a pipe-relining job is increased with the number of bends in the pipe. Our experts have lined many sewer lines with bends in them.

Although this can be challenging, it’s not impossible and we have the expertise and the knowledge to get this job done right.

Can Sliplining Stop Tree Roots From Entering Pipes?

Yes trenchless pipe relining solutions can help to stop tree roots from entering your sewer. Sliplining is the job process of creating a new pipe within the old one, which helps to seal off any openings or cracks which can allow trees to enter.

Furthermore, regular maintenance and cleaning of your drainage system can help prevent tree roots from getting into them.

Can A Collapsed Pipe Be Relined?

We cannot reline the pipe that has collapsed. If you have a pipe that has collapsed, you will require replacing the pipe in its entirety. If you’re unsure what the damage is to your pipe, we can come out and conduct an inspection for you.

Will Pipe Relining Affect The Pipe Flow?

There is generally no change in pipe flow as a result of the relining of pipes. Relining pipes is often a way to increase the amount of flow that flows through the pipe due to the fact that it provides a smooth, new area for water to flow through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been Around?

Pipe relining was used for a long time, with the first documented case was in 1854. But it wasn’t until the beginning of the 2000’s that it started to be more commonly used.

Pipe relining technology is used all over the world as an effective solution to fix leaks or damaged pipes, without having to dig them up to replace them entirely. There are many different types of pipe relining services that can be employed according to the type of pipe as well as the severity in the extent of damage.

There is, for instance, spot pipe relining Lynbrook, which is used to fix small leaks and structural pipe relining which is used for more serious damage. Whatever type of pipe relining used, the purpose is the same: to repair the pipe without replacing it completely.
